How they compare

Philippines currently reports 32.6% against 32.0% in Trinidad and Tobago, a difference of 0.6%.

Across all 35 years both countries report, Philippines has been ahead every year.

Philippines ranks 93rd and Trinidad and Tobago ranks 96th of 187 countries.

Philippines has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Philippines Trinidad and Tobago Difference Ahead
1990s 46.9% 26.4% 20.5% Philippines
2000s 44.7% 25.4% 19.3% Philippines
2010s 36.1% 28.0% 8.1% Philippines
2020s 33.2% 31.7% 1.6% Philippines

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Self-employed workers are those workers who, working on their own account or with one or a few partners or in cooperative, hold the type of jobs defined as a "self-employment jobs." i.e. jobs where the remuneration is directly dependent upon the profits derived from the goods and services produced. Self-employed workers include sub-categories of employers, own-account workers and members of producers' cooperatives and contributing family workers.
